What makes a moment of doubt evolve into a defining career milestone? For Robert Downey Jr., a dramatic setback in 2003—dubbed one of Hollywood’s most high-stakes crossroads—became the catalyst for a renaissance few anticipated. His story isn’t just about talent; it’s about resilience, reinvention, and the strategic navigation of failure in a public eye.
